Crispy, light, savory air fryer potatoes roasted and dressed with olive oil, lemon, and fresh herbs. Ready in 20 minutes, these are an easy, versatile side for any meal!
Servings: 4 people
Calories: 151kcal
Ingredients
Potatoes
- 1 pound fingerling potatoes
- olive oil spray or about 1 teaspoon olive oil
Dressing
- 2 tablespoons olive oil extra virgin
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 clove garlic small
- ½ teaspoon fresh rosemary or thyme leaves chopped finely if using rosemary
- kosher salt to taste
Instructions
Potatoes
-
Wash your potatoes, being sure to scrub off any dirt, and dry well. Remove any eyes, green sections, or brown portions of the potatoes. Slice in half lengthwise.
-
Spray lightly with olive oil spray or toss with about 1 teaspoon of olive oil, season with salt, and add to the air fryer basket.
-
Set the air fryer for 15 minutes at 350°F. Check for a golden brown, crisp exterior and a soft, fully cooked interior. Add more time if needed.
Dressing
- In the meantime, add your lemon juice, olive oil, thyme, and salt to a small jar or bowl. Grate the garlic with a Microplane or mince finely and add to the mixture. Add the lid and shake or whisk until combined.
- Once cooked, toss the potatoes in the dressing, taste for seasoning, adding salt if needed, and serve immediately.
Notes
- Avoid crowding the air fryer basket. Work in batches to give the potatoes room to brown evenly.
- To store leftovers, cool and and then place in an airtight container, making sure to transfer to the fridge within 2 hours of cooking for food safety reasons.
- Potatoes will last for 3 to 5 days in the fridge when stored in an airtight container.
- You can make these potatoes ahead of time, but they will not maintain their crispiness.
- You can reheat this in the oven for 10-20 minutes at 400°F or in the microwave for a few minutes. Microwaved potatoes have a tendency to be a bit dry, so try to reserve some dressing for after they are reheated.
- If you plan to freeze these potatoes, do so before adding the dressing. They will last for up to 4 months in the freezer. Cool completely and store in an airtight container. Freezing will impact the texture of the potato.
- To reheat from frozen, thaw in the refrigerator overnight and then reheat in the oven or microwave as above.
- You can also reheat in the air fryer at 350°F. Check every few minutes to see when they are ready.
- If your potatoes come with sections that are green, cut these sections off. The green sections will taste bitter.
- If you are concerned about your first batch getting cold, heat your regular oven to its lowest setting, usually 170 to 200°F, and place your potatoes in the preheated oven in an oven-safe dish.
